Common Samsonuninstall.exe Errors on Windows

Encountering errors associated with samsonuninstall.exe can be frustrating. These errors may vary in nature and can surface due to different reasons, such as software conflicts, outdated drivers, or even malware infections. Below, we've outlined the most commonly reported errors linked to samsonuninstall.exe, to aid in understanding and potentially resolving the issues at hand.

  • Error 0xc0000005: This warning appears when the system encounters an access violation problem. This could be due to issues with memory, malware affecting the system, or drivers that need updating.
  • Not a Valid Win32 Application: This alert pops up when the system is unable to start a program, either due to incompatibility with the current Windows version or potential corruption of the program file.
  • Insufficient System Resources Exist to Complete the Requested Service: This warning is displayed when there are not enough system resources available to execute the service required. This can happen when there is an overconsumption of system memory or high CPU demand.
  • Samsonuninstall.exe Application Error: This generic error can occur due to various reasons like corrupt files, bad sectors on a hard drive, or insufficient system resources.
  • Missing Samsonuninstall.exe File: This alert comes up when the system is unable to locate the necessary executable file. Samsonuninstall.exe could have been removed, relocated, or the provided file path might be incorrect.

Run the Deployment Image Servicing and Management (DISM) to Fix the samsonuninstall.exe Error

In this guide, we will aim to resolve issues related to samsonuninstall.exe by utilizing the Deployment Image Servicing and Management (DISM) tool to scan and repair Windows system files.

Step 1: Open Command Prompt

Step 1: Open Command Prompt Thumbnail
  1. Press the Windows key.

  2. Type Command Prompt in the search bar.

  3.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.

Step 2: Run DISM Scan

Step 2: Run DISM Scan Thumbnail
  1. In the Command Prompt window, type DISM /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th and press Enter.

  2. Allow the Deployment Image Servicing and Management tool to scan your system and correct any errors it detects.
